    Relations between Preschool Children’s Planning Ability, Self-Regulation and Early Literacy Skills

    Thirty preschool children (18 boys, mean age = 54 months, SD = 6.82, range = 39 to 67 months) were recruited from a local University preschool center. Experimenters visited the preschool on one occasion and administered planning and inhibitory control tasks. Teachers’ reported on children’s temperament and data regarding early literacy skills. Consistent with expectations, teacher-rated attention focusing and inhibitory control were associated with better observed inhibitory control. Results unexpectedly showed that higher observed inhibitory control and lower teacher-rated anger/frustration, sadness, high intensity pleasure, and impulsivity, and higher teacher-rated inhibitory control and soothability were associated with a greater number of trials needed for successful completion of the two planning tasks. Perhaps children with better inhibitory control and lower overall difficulties in temperament were more likely to persist to completion in the face of task complexity

    Cultural Biases in the Weschler Memory Scale iii (WMS-iii)

    The Wechsler Memory Scale –iii is the newest version of a six-decade old neuropsychological inventory. Since its conception, the Wechsler Memory Scale has been highly utilized by practitioners to accurately assess various memory functions in adult subjects. Revisions made within this inventory include the Faces I subtest, a facial recognition scale, which was added in order to strengthen the instrument’s accuracy at measuring episodic memory. Facial recognition, both cross-race and within-race, has been researched extensively and consistent biases have been found between race of test taker and cross-racial identification. Theories of exposure/contextual interaction (environment) and biological foundations have been the subject of study in the past in order to determine from where these racial identification deficits stem. The current study focuses on revealing bias in the Faces I subtest, regarding to an unequal distribution of racially representative faces in the testing materials. Eighty-eight college students were recruited to view forty-eight pictured faces from the Faces I subtest and determine the racial category to which the pictured face belonged. The subjects’ categorical responses were the basis for calculating a percent agreement score for racial category of each face. It was determined, using the results of subjects’ responses, that the Faces I subtest contained an unequal distribution of racially representative faces in both the Target and Interference testing material. This confirmed the presence of an inherent bias within the subscale. The implications of memory accuracy for the WMS-iii are discussed as it relates to different fields of study, but none more directly than the criminal justice system. Eyewitness testimony is a pivotal evidentiary tool in the criminal justice system, and ramifications of cross-racial identification deficits and biases in the tools to accurately assess memory are increasingly bringing this once heavily relied upon tool into question

    Faculty Adoption of Computer Technology for Instruction in the North Carolina Community College System.

    Computer technology has become an integral part of instruction at the elementary, secondary, and postsecondary levels. Some instructors have enthusiastically adopted technological innovations in their classrooms, often expending their own funds for hardware and software, while others have resisted the trend, citing a myriad of reasons for not including computer technology. Significant research on the adoption of innovations has been undertaken by Everett M. Rogers, who identified individuals on a continuum from Innovator to Laggard. Rogers’ research was used as a basis to classify full-time faculty teaching in degree programs in the North Carolina Community College System and to compare these faculty members on five demographic variables. While faculty did not differ on age, gender or race/ethnicity, they did differ regarding their years of teaching experience and highest degree attained. Faculty in the North Carolina Community College were further identified as either users or non-users of computer technology in instruction and were analyzed on the same five demographic characteristics as were evaluated with the Rogers continuum. No differences were found in any of the five categories. Faculty members who reported employing technology for instruction often utilized multiple techniques, such as e-mail contact with students, posting assignments and other information on course websites, and using course management software for recordkeeping functions. Non-users identified a number of reasons for not incorporating technology into instruction, as well as which strategies might be employed to encourage them to adopt computer technology into instruction. Faculty classified as users or non-users of computer technology in instruction identified the presence of technology change agents in their organizations, and stated that other faculty members, or the president or other members of senior administration filled these roles

    Supposed trans-Atlantic migration of Heterostegina around the Eocene/Oligocene boundary

    According to our hypothesis, Heterostegina ocalana migrated eastward through the previously much narrower Atlantic Ocean around the Eocene/Oligocene boundary. Sporadic populations of H. n. sp., its phylogenetic successor, survived in the western part of the Neotethys until the end of the Rupelian, when they became extinct

    Regulating Non-territorial Commercial Environments in Territorial-based Legal Systems

    The purpose of the following work is the identification and analysis of the legal and technological challenges that transnational electronic commerce carried out over open computermediated networks presents to legal systems based on territorial principles in order to delineate global and systematic solutions to this new non-territorial commercial environment. A possible global, systematic and technologically oriented legal solution will create a new commercial environment safer for consumers, more predictable for businesses and with equal opportunities of access and growth for all countries

    Numerical implementation of a functional observability algorithm : a singular value decomposition approach

    The paper outlines a numerical algorithm to implement the concept of Functional Observability introduced in [6] based on a Singular Value Decomposition approach. The key feature of this algorithm is in outputting a minimum number of additional linear functions of the state vector when the system is Functional Observable, these additional functions are required to design the smallest possible order functional observer as stated in [6]

    Functional observability

    A simple theorem for Functional Observability is presented considering the observable and unobservable states of a system based on Kalman decomposition. The proposed theorem is also consistent with two other theorems on Functional Observability which was based on eigen decomposition [6]. The paper also reports a new definition for Functional Observability which is consistent with previously reported definitions and theorems [4], [5], [6]
